For years, phishing awareness training taught employees to look for the same red flags: awkward grammar, generic greetings, mismatched sender addresses, urgent demands with obvious typos. That advice was genuinely useful when phishing emails were written by humans without native fluency in the target’s language, working from templates that looked slightly off if you knew what to check.
AI has quietly erased most of those tells. A modern phishing email can be grammatically flawless, written in a tone that matches the supposed sender’s actual style, and personalized with details scraped from LinkedIn, company newsletters, or old email threads. The old checklist doesn’t catch this generation of attacks, and training programs still built around it are teaching employees to look for signals that mostly aren’t there anymore. What Changed, Specifically
The writing itself got dramatically better
AI tools can now draft a convincing, personalized phishing email in minutes, mimicking a specific person’s writing style if enough of their public communication is available to learn from. The generic, poorly worded phishing email is increasingly the exception rather than the rule.
Voice cloning entered the picture
A short audio clip, sometimes just a few seconds pulled from a podcast, webinar recording, or voicemail greeting, is enough to generate a convincing synthetic voice. Attackers are pairing AI-written emails with a follow-up phone call in a cloned executive’s voice to add urgency and legitimacy to a fraudulent wire transfer request.
Video deepfakes have entered live meetings
The most sophisticated version of this attack involves a live video call with what appears to be a real executive, using real-time deepfake technology. An employee at a major engineering firm authorized a $25 million wire transfer after joining a video call where every participant, including the person who appeared to be the CFO, was AI-generated.
The scale has genuinely shifted
This isn’t a rare, exotic threat anymore. The FBI’s Internet Crime Complaint Center added AI-assisted fraud as a standalone tracking category in its 2025 Internet Crime Report for the first time, logging thousands of complaints and hundreds of millions of dollars in losses tied specifically to synthetic voice and video impersonation. That’s a strong signal that this category of attack has moved from emerging risk to established threat.
Why Traditional Training Falls Short Against This
|
Traditional Training Focus |
Why It No Longer Works |
|
Look for spelling and grammar errors |
AI-written phishing emails are typically grammatically correct |
|
Check for generic greetings |
AI can personalize greetings using scraped public information |
|
Distrust unfamiliar senders |
Attackers now impersonate known, trusted contacts convincingly |
|
Rely on visual or audio verification |
Deepfake video and cloned voices can pass a casual visual or audio check |
|
Annual training session |
A single yearly session doesn’t build the habits needed against evolving tactics |
The pattern across this table is that verification methods people have relied on instinctively (does this sound right, does this look right) no longer reliably work, because those are exactly the signals AI-generated attacks are built to replicate.
What Training Actually Needs to Cover Now
Verification habits that don’t rely on how something sounds or looks
Employees need a standing process for confirming unusual requests, especially financial ones, through a separate, pre-established channel rather than relying on how convincing the call or video looked. A callback to a known number, not the one provided in the suspicious message, is a simple habit that defeats even a highly convincing voice clone.
Awareness that video and voice can now be faked convincingly
Training needs to explicitly cover the reality that a familiar voice or face on a call is no longer sufficient verification on its own, something most existing training programs haven’t caught up to yet.
Frequent, realistic simulation instead of annual sessions
Regular phishing simulations that evolve to reflect current AI-driven tactics build habits far more effectively than a once-a-year training video, since recognizing a threat under simulated pressure is a very different skill than remembering a slide from months earlier.
A clear, low-friction reporting process
Employees need to know exactly how to report a suspicious message or call without friction or embarrassment, since hesitation to report a near-miss often means the same attack succeeds against someone else in the organization shortly after.
Building a Program That Keeps Up
The businesses handling this well tend to treat security awareness training as an ongoing program rather than a compliance requirement to satisfy once a year. That includes updating training content as attack methods evolve, running simulations that reflect current tactics rather than outdated templates, and reinforcing verification habits regularly enough that they become automatic rather than theoretical.
